Output 22639c6fa4780b92f3687d0346f39cd2fe0f2b6445ee4de2b3831c4f10af7b91:0

value
17429383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75b8ecfede79c830de4392bbf8356057c5d924a1 OP_EQUALVERIFY OP_CHECKSIG
address
1BjTbK4spmaMLRefevaFKiv9opBYTnGY63
transaction
22639c6fa4780b92f3687d0346f39cd2fe0f2b6445ee4de2b3831c4f10af7b91
spent
true